The choice between a blazer and a cardigan can make or break an outfit. A blazer adds instant polish, while a cardigan provides cozy comfort. This decision affects the overall aesthetic and feel of the wearer. It's a trade-off between structure and softness.
Why each side wins
🧥 Blazer
A blazer elevates any outfit with its structured design and lapels. It adds a level of sophistication and professionalism. This makes it ideal for formal events or work settings. The blazer's crispness creates a sharp, put-together look.
🧶 Cardigan
A cardigan offers a relaxed, casual vibe that's perfect for everyday wear. Its soft-knit material provides warmth without stiffness. This makes it great for layering over dresses or tops. The cardigan's cozy feel creates a comfortable, laid-back atmosphere.

The verdict
The decision comes down to personal style and occasion. Those who prioritize polish and professionalism may lean towards a blazer. Others who value comfort and a relaxed look may prefer a cardigan.

Frequently asked
- Can a blazer be worn casually?
- Yes, a blazer can be dressed down for a more casual look by pairing it with jeans or a t-shirt.
- Is a cardigan only for cold weather?
- No, a cardigan can be worn in various temperatures as a layering piece to add texture and interest to an outfit.
- Can I wear a blazer over a cardigan?
- Yes, layering a blazer over a cardigan can create a stylish, versatile look that combines structure and comfort.
